Carolina University Baseball Wins Series Against Bluefield University

This past weekend, Carolina University baseball hosted Bluefield University for an exciting game at Truist Stadium and two-game series at Rich Park. Carolina took two out of three games, improving their season record to 5-9, while Bluefield dropped to 1-17.

Game 1 - Bluefield 17, Carolina 4

The series opener on March 7th saw Bluefield dominate Carolina with a decisive 17-4 victory. Bluefield's offense erupted early, scoring eight runs in the first three innings and maintaining pressure throughout the game. J. Germosen and N. Diaz were offensive standouts for Bluefield, with Germosen hitting a home run and a triple, while Diaz added a double and multiple RBIs. Carolina's pitching staff struggled to contain the Bluefield lineup, with Derek Martinez taking the loss after giving up eight runs, four of them earned.

Carolina's attempts to rally were led by Paxton  Tucker and A. Delgado, but Bluefield's pitching, anchored by G. Peel, limited Carolina's opportunities. Peel threw six strong innings, allowing only three runs while striking out five.

Game 2 - Carolina 4, Bluefield 2

Carolina responded on March 8th, winning a tight 4-2 contest. Kaleb Whitaker delivered an impressive pitching performance for Carolina, throwing a complete game and allowing only two hits while striking out eight batters. Despite defensive errors, Carolina's offense managed to produce timely hits, with Paxton Tucker and Alejandro Rodriguez driving in runs. Bluefield's J. Brower took the loss, despite keeping the game close until Carolina added insurance runs late.

Game 3 - Carolina 8, Bluefield 6

The final game of the series saw Carolina secure a thrilling 8-6 victory, clinching the series. Danny Gonzalez was the star of the game for Carolina, blasting a three-run home run in the first inning to give his team an early lead. Bluefield countered with a four-run third inning, fueled by N. Diaz's grand slam. However, Carolina regained control in the fourth and fifth innings, adding five runs to create enough separation to hold off Bluefield's late-game surge.

Alex Prevost picked up the win for Carolina, while Jamie Winecoff closed out the final innings. Bluefield's W. Ricketts took the loss, giving up eight runs (three earned) over 4.1 innings.
